District's Operations and Maintenance Department.
Job duties include assisting in the maintenance and operational activities of storm drain pipelines, valves, fences, dams, reservoirs, channels, outfall structures, levees, electrical and diesel-powered pumps as well as smaller gasoline powered pumps.
Typically, the work is performed in wet and muddy conditions on steep side slopes and requires the use of 4x4 trucks ( which are issued by the District for District use only ) with winches and significant labor to set up several hundred feet of suction and discharge hose. Ability to safely hitch, unhitch, and back utility trailers, pump mounted trailers and fuel trailers and the ability
to work alone and in small teams while using good safety practices is required. Assignments are primarily outdoors and require good physical condition to withstand hot summer, and cold rainy winter, working conditions.
Experience in construction and the ability to perform a variety of maintenance tasks including electrical and mechanical maintenance are also desirable. This position rotates on-call responsibilities (evenings, weekends, holidays) as needed. M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S The Facilities Technician I position requires a high school diploma or equivalent, and one year of general experience in industrial maintenance, water conveyance, or related field experience. A valid California
Driver License and good driving record are required. Facilities Technicians (except those assigned to the Operations Center) must be available to respond to emergencies at District sites within short periods of time.
Facilities Technicians must reside in the Fresno/Clovis area within 12 miles of the intersection of Mc Kinley Avenue and First Street, the approximate center-point of the District's urban service area. Manufacturing or Operations jobs pertain to roles involved in the production of goods and management of supply chains. These positions can range from hands-on tasks such as assembly line work, machining, and quality control, to supervisory roles overseeing production processes and logistics. Characteristics of these jobs often include a focus on efficiency, productivity, and adherence to safety protocols. Employees in this sector typically engage with physical products and manufacturing equipment, and may work in structured shifts within factories or production facilities. Advancement in this field frequently hinges on technical expertise, process management skills, and the capacity to optimize workflows.
